<h3>Safety first in alpine environments</h3>
<ul>
<li>Weather readiness: Alpine weather can change quickly. Pack layerable clothing, waterproof jackets, and sturdy shoes. Always check forecast updates before heading out on hikes or lake activities.</li>
<li>Sun protection: Even on cool days, the sun can be strong at altitude. Pack sunscreen, hats, and sunglasses for each family member.</li>
<li>Water safety: When near water bodies, supervise children closely and use life jackets for boating or shallow-water activities.</li>
<li>Trail safety: Choose family-friendly routes with clear markings and short durations. Carry a simple map, a small first-aid kit, and a charged mobile phone for emergencies.</li>
</ul>

<h3>Packing and preparation tips for Austrian family travel</h3>
<ul>
<li>Nutrition and snacks: Pack familiar snacks you know your children enjoy, plus a small selection of Austrian staples to enjoy during day trips.</li>
<li>Baby-proofing essentials: If traveling with infants, bring portable baby gates, a compact high chair, and a lightweight stroller for easy transit in narrow streets.</li>
<li>Electrical adapters: Austria uses Type C and Type F plugs; pack universal adapters for devices and chargers.</li>
</ul>

<h2>Local dining and grocery options for families</h2>
<p>Austria is famous for its family-friendly hospitality and approachable dining. In Taxenbach, Zell am See, and the surrounding valleys, you’ll find a mix of einheimische Gerichte (local dishes) and familiar options that appeal to children. Look for restaurants offering child-sized portions, high chairs, and quiet seating zones. Supermarkets like Billa, Spar, and Hofer (Aldi) typically provide fresh bread, fruit, dairy, and easy-to-prepare meals—perfect for a quick dinner after a day outdoors.</p>
